Discreet Tools: What's Allowed
When it comes to discreet personal protection keychain tools, understanding what’s allowed under the law is essential for peace of mind. These keychains are designed to be easily portable and virtually invisible, providing a sense of security in various situations. Common options include small pepper spray canisters, pocket-sized stun guns, and tactical flashlights with protective features.
The legality of these tools varies by state, so it’s crucial to check local regulations. Many states permit the carrying of self-defense sprays, such as pepper or pepper-based irritants, without a permit as long as they meet certain size and strength criteria. Stun guns, however, often require registration or a concealed carry license. Tactical flashlights must also adhere to brightness and weight restrictions to be considered legal for everyday carry.
